How do you cut copper sheet?

How do you cut copper sheet? For higher gauges (meaning thinner copper) you can easily do it with standard hardware store metal snips. They look like big scissors and work the same way. For thicker copper sheet you would want to use a jewelry saw, it’s a bit slower, but gives you a nicer finished cutting edge.

Can you cut copper sheet with a table saw? You can cut sheet metal using your table saw, provided you pick a blade designed for metal. Even with the correct blade, though, it is dangerous. Make sure you cut very slowly and use proper safety gear. … You should always keep this in mind when cutting through ferrous metals.

Can you cut copper with tin snips? Using snips is considered one of the most common ways of cutting copper sheets. This is mostly due to how easy and affordable it is. If you’re working with high and medium gauge sheet metal, then using tin snips is ideal.

Can you cut copper sheet with a plasma cutter? Plasma cutters offer flexibility to cut most types of metal in varying thicknesses, including steel, stainless, aluminum, copper, bronze, brass, titanium, Inconel and other materials.

Is copper an element or alloy?

Copper is a chemical element with the symbol Cu (from Latin: cuprum) and atomic number 29. It is a soft, malleable, and ductile metal with very high thermal and electrical conductivity.

What color is the lettering on type l copper pipe?

These letter codes are also used in relating the color printed on a pipe to the type it represents. The color assists in identifying the type of copper pipe. Green represents type K, blue represents type L, red represents type M, and yellow represents type DWV.

What happens when copper sulphate is heated strongly?

When copper sulphate (CuSO4. 5H2O) crystals are heated strongly, they lose all the water of crystallisation and form anhydrous copper sulphate, which is white.

Who discovered copper chloride?

Copper(I) chloride was first prepared by Robert Boyle in the mid-seventeenth century from mercury(II) chloride (“Venetian sublimate”) and copper metal: HgCl2 + 2 Cu → 2 CuCl + Hg. In 1799, J.L. Proust characterized the two different chlorides of copper.

Why is copper used as anode x rays?

Copper anodes are by far the most common (as shown above left) since copper gives the shortest wavelength above 1 Å. The wavelengths provided by, say, molybdenum and silver are normally too short for most powder diffraction work in the laboratory.

What is wire copper thhn?

THHN wire is a very popular type of building wire used in all types of industrial, commercial and residential construction. This type of building wire is effective in damp and dry locations. THHN stands for Thermoplastic High Heat Nylon which is a description of the wire jacket and insulation components.

Where do the copper inuit live?

Copper Inuit also known as Kitlinermiut) and Inuinnait are a Canadian Inuit group who live north of the tree line, in what is now Nunavut’s Kitikmeot Region and the Northwest Territories’s Inuvik Region. Most historically lived in the area around Coronation Gulf, on Victoria Island, and southern Banks Island.

How much psi can 3 4 copper pipe hold?

Type M, 3/4-inch drawn copper pipe handles a maximum of 701 pounds per square inch at 100 degrees. The same size and type of annealed copper pipe has a maximum pressure rating of just 337 pounds per square inch.
